The son and daughters of the late Ethna Teague would like to extend our heartfelt thanks to our extended family members, friends and neighbours for their kindness, sympathy, support and generosity in our recent sad loss of our dear Mum.

We are especially grateful to those who attended Mum's wake, funeral, sent mass cards, flowers and shared many fond memories. Your kind words have brought a great comfort and solace to us at this difficult time.

We convey our appreciation to both Fr Hasson who attended Mum in her final days and provided spiritual guidance to us and Mum. Also, to Fr McCartan who led such a respectful, meaningful mass and for his fitting eulogy of our Mum. Thanks also to the Eucharistic Ministers.

A huge thank you to all of Mum' s carers over the past number of years, who were so kind to her, and friendships were made. We will treasure the memories of your care and compassion.

A special word of thanks goes to Mum’s niece Shauna and husband Mark for the beautiful music and singing which touched us so deeply. Your contribution was incredibly special.

Our deepest gratitude goes to Dr Corry, Dr Brown and all the staff at Carrickmore Health Centre, The District Nurses, Marie Curie and the Rapid Response Team for their care and compassion shown to Mum during her final days.

Thank you to Farley’s Funeral Directors especially Fergal and Paddy, for their professional, dignified and compassionate funeral arrangements and to the gravediggers who prepared Mum’s final resting place.

Thank you to Farley’s Bar, Beragh for the refreshments after the funeral and to our close friends and family who helped in the kitchen throughout the wake, especially Caroline. Thanks is also extended to Killyclogher GFC and to Beragh Red Knights.

We trust this acknowledgement will be accepted as a token of our sincere gratitude.
Go raibh míle maith agaibh.

Mum’s Month’s Mind will be celebrated in The Church of the Immaculate Conception, Beragh on Thursday 21st August 2025 at 7.30 pm.
